The 20-year-old Grammy winner has designed a sustainable AF 1 High Mushroom sneaker, which is a "fresh" take on the iconic shoe.
“The challenge and opportunity with this collection was to respect the originals but make them my own.
“It was also important for me to mix in environmentally preferred materials where we could and present them in a way that felt fresh,” she said in a press release.
The beige footwear boasts Billie's Blohsh logo on the lace dubraes, and the insoles feature the slogan: 'It’s hard to stop it once it starts.'

As well as the Air Force 1s, the Happier Than Ever singer has a number of loungewear items on the way, including a fleece hoodie, t-shirt, and sweatpants in the same neutral shades.
The Billie Eilish x Nike Air Force 1 High Mushroom and apparel line will first be available on 24 April via Billie's website and Nike SNKRS on 25 April.
Last year, Billie launched a vegan Air Jordan sneaker collection.
The singer created two silhouettes, a take on the Air Jordan 1 KO and the Air Jordan 15 in lime green and a nude colour.
The megastar gushed that it was a "surreal experience" getting to collaborate with the Jordan Brand on her own designs of the signature shoes made famous by the retired basketball champion, Michael Jordan.
